2012-05-30 4 views
1

mkvirtualenv를 사용하여 virtualenv에 대해 PYTHONPATH를 자동으로 구성 할 수 있습니까? 내 ~/.bashrc에 PYTHONPATH를 정의하지 않고 각 가상 노드에 정의합니다. 비활성화 기능에virtualenvs에서 자동으로 PYTHONPATH 정의

: 나는 새로운 VIRTUALENV를 만들 때마다, 나는 수동으로 $VIRTUAL_ENV/bin/activate에이 줄을 넣어야 할

unset PYTHONPATH 

외부 비활성화 :

PYTHONPATH="$VIRTUAL_ENV/lib/python2.7/site-packages" 

나는 이러한 넣어 싶습니다 mkvirtualenv를 사용하여 자동으로 행. 나는 virtualenv 1.7.1.2를 사용하고있다.

답변

0

경로 $VIRTUAL_ENV/lib/python2.7/site-packages은 virtualenv에서 기본값입니다. 난 단지 내 시스템에서 ipython을 제거하고 VIRTUALENV 내부에 그것을 설치 : 따라서

workon myvirtualenv 
pip install ipython 

를, 내가 사용 ipython 내부 사용하여 경로를 확인 :

import sys 
sys.path 
관련 문제